Abstract

The utility model relates to the technical field of soldering and discloses stirring equipment for preparing soldering paste, wherein mounting shaft seats are arranged at the positions above two sides of a support of a supporting vertical frame, stirrers are arranged at the output ends of the two groups of mounting shaft seats in a penetrating manner, a stirring box is sleeved outside a shaft rod of the stirrer in a wrapping manner, and a locking mechanism fixedly connected with the supporting vertical frame is arranged at one side of a box body of the stirring box. According to the utility model, after the stirring of the soldering paste is finished, the stirred soldering paste can be automatically and spirally conveyed and discharged by utilizing the spiral pushing of the spiral pushing propeller in the stirrer, so that the discharging strength of a worker is reduced, and after the discharging is finished, the stirring box can be turned and horizontally placed by utilizing the turning lock catch of the locking mechanism to the stirring box, so that the residual materials are conveniently and conveniently taken, on one hand, the taking strength of the worker can be reduced, on the other hand, equipment is not required to be manually and frequently installed, and the operation accuracy of the equipment is ensured.

Description

Stirring equipment for preparing soldering paste
Technical Field
The utility model relates to the technical field of soldering, in particular to stirring equipment for preparing soldering paste.
Background
The solder paste is a gray paste, is a novel welding material which is generated along with SMT, is a paste mixture formed by mixing soldering powder, soldering flux, other surfactants, thixotropic agents and the like, and is mainly used for welding surface resistance, capacitance, IC and other electronic components in the SMT industry, and various raw materials of the solder paste need to be stirred and mixed when the solder paste is prepared, for example, the prior patent technology shows that: through retrieving, chinese patent net discloses a agitating unit (publication No. CN 216572747U) that solder paste preparation was used, and this kind of device drives the threaded rod through rotating the handle and removes in the inside of screw hole, and the threaded rod of being convenient for makes to remove and drives the stripper plate and remove and carry out the clamping fixed to the agitator tank to avoid the agitator tank to take place to rock and drop in rotatory.
However, there are some disadvantages to the solder paste stirring devices adopted in the above-mentioned published patent and the existing market: such adoption stripper plate removes and carries out the fixed mode of clamping to the agitator tank, and its operation intensity is higher on the one hand, and when agitator tank and tin solder were heavier, to the getting of the interior tin solder paste of agitator tank blowing all comparatively loaded down with trivial details, on the other hand manual go on, the mode of unloading, operation accuracy is relatively poor, very easy installation mistake's condition. Referring to fig. 1-4, a stirring device for preparing soldering paste comprises a supporting vertical frame 1, mounting shaft seats 4 are arranged at positions above a bracket of the supporting vertical frame 1, output ends of the two groups of mounting shaft seats 4 penetrate through a stirrer 9, a stirring box 5 is sleeved outside a shaft rod of the stirrer 9, a discharging valve 6 is communicated with the bottom end of the stirring box 5 at the middle position, an opening and closing end cover 8 is connected with the top end of the stirring box 5 at the position of a material opening, two groups of electric push rods 7 connected with the opening and closing end cover 8 are symmetrically connected with two sides of the stirring box 5, when the stirring device is used for stirring soldering paste, raw materials of the soldering paste are poured into the stirring box 5, then the telescopic ends of the electric push rods 7 shrink, the opening and closing end cover 8 is pulled to be closed, and the soldering paste in the stirring box 5 is stirred in a sealing mode.
The agitator motor 3 of fixing at the support riser 1 support opposite side is installed to the one end output of agitator 9, is utilizing agitated vessel to stir the in-process to the soldering paste, and agitator motor 3 work drives the transmission shaft 91 of agitator 9 and rotates, then drives the screw push paddle 92 of its shaft end, stirring paddle 94 rotation, stirs the mixed work to the soldering paste.
The stirrer 9 comprises a transmission shaft 91, a screw propeller 92 is arranged at the shaft end of the transmission shaft 91, a plurality of groups of stirring support arms 93 are arranged at the shaft end of the transmission shaft 91 along the screw direction of the screw propeller 92, stirring paddles 94 are arranged at both ends of arm rods of the stirring support arms 93, the screw propeller 92 is bounded by a central line, positive and negative screw propeller blades which are symmetrically arranged with each other are respectively arranged at both sides of the central line, a plurality of groups of stirring support arms 93 are arranged at equal intervals relative to the shaft direction of the transmission shaft 91, and two adjacent groups of stirring support arms 93 are vertically and symmetrically arranged in the ninety degrees direction, in the stirring process of the solder paste by using stirring equipment, the screw propeller 92 can be used for continuously pushing the solder paste to the middle part in a screw manner when rotating, so that the mixture ratio of the solder paste raw materials is improved, and the stirring paddles 94 can be used for continuously stirring and mixing the solder paste raw materials when rotating, so that the solder paste raw materials are more fully stirred and mixed.
The locking mechanism fixedly connected with the supporting vertical frame 1 is arranged on one side of the box body of the stirring box 5, the locking mechanism comprises a locking vertical frame 10 arranged on one side of a bracket of the supporting vertical frame 1, a vertical placing socket 11 arranged on one side of the box body of the stirring box 5 along the vertical axis of the stirring box 9 and a horizontal placing socket 12 arranged on one side of the box body of the stirring box 5 along the horizontal axis of the stirring box 9, locking sockets 13 are arranged at the top ends of arm rods of the locking vertical frame 10, the vertical placing socket 11 and the horizontal placing socket 12 are symmetrically arranged at an included angle of ninety degrees relative to the axis of the stirring box 9, the vertical placing socket 11 and the horizontal placing socket 12 are respectively in one-to-one correspondence with the locking sockets 13, a horizontal placing frame 2 corresponding to the stirring box 5 is arranged on the front side of the bracket of the supporting vertical frame 1, after the stirring and mixing of soldering paste raw materials are completed, a switch of a discharging valve 6 can be opened, and afterwards utilize the spiral propelling movement of spiral propelling movement oar 92, with the spiral propelling movement of soldering paste to the discharge valve 6 open end, carry out autonomous unloading work to the soldering paste, and after unloading, can take out supporting bolt in from hasp socket 13 and the socket 12 of keeping flat, release and erect the hasp state, then place forward, lean on keeping flat on horizontal shelf 2, then insert the bolt in hasp socket 13 and the socket 11 of putting upright, form and put the hasp state transversely, open and close end cover 8 then, utilize the stirring of agitator 9 to drive, drive the discharge through the opening stirring with the soldering paste raw materials in the agitator tank 5, in order to ensure the comprehensively of soldering paste discharge, on the one hand, it can reduce staff's material taking intensity, on the other hand need not artifical frequent dismouting whole equipment, ensure the accuracy of equipment operation.
